Engine

Recall date November 4, 2021
Models affected
  • 2012 Hyundai Veloster
  • 2013 Hyundai Veloster
  • 2014 Hyundai Veloster
  • 2015 Hyundai Veloster
  • 2016 Hyundai Veloster
  • 2017 Hyundai Veloster
Units affected 32,431
Details

Issue: Hyundai Auto Canada is conducting a Product Improvement Campaign that provides an update to the engine control module to detect potential problems before an engine fails.

An engine failure would cause a sudden loss of power with an inability to restart.

Note: This only affects Santa Fe models equipped with a 2.4 L MPI engine, and Veloster models with a 1.6 L GDI engine.

Safety Risk: A sudden loss of engine power could increase the risk of an accident.

An engine failure could also create the risk of a fire.

Corrective Actions: Hyundai will notify owners by mail and advise you to take your vehicle to a dealer to update the software for the engine control module.

Note: Hyundai recommends that you should always follow the correct vehicle maintenance schedule, which is printed in the Owner's Manual.

If you experience unusual engine noise, reduced power, or a check engine/oil warning light, Hyundai advises you to immediately visit a Hyundai dealership to have your vehicle diagnosed.
